A grand $9 million penthouse offered with a 69-foot Ferretti yacht

A grand penthouse, a 69-Foot Ferretti Yacht and a 70-foot wet slip offered in one package in the Yachting Capital of the World

 

Marina Palms Yacht Club & Residences, Miami’s first new high-rise residences with private marina in two decades, and Ferretti Group, one of the world’s leading players in the design, construction and sale of motor yachts have announced an exclusive $9 million package. The pair is offering a Grand Penthouse — complete with a customized Steven G interior design — a 69-foot Ferretti 690 yacht and a 70-foot wet slip.

The Grand Penthouse is 4,300 sq. ft. with 600 ft. of terrace space and features four bedrooms, 4 1/2 bathrooms and comes standard with secured elevator access, Snaidero cabinetry, stone counter tops, and Wolf, Miele and Sub-Zero appliances including a dual-zoned wine storage unit that holds up to 78 bottles. It also includes two reserved parking spaces, and unobstructed, panoramic waterfront views across the marina and east to the Intracoastal and the Atlantic.

This partnership is a great fit for Ferretti Group and yachting enthusiasts for a variety of reasons, said Brett Keating, VP Marketing with Ferretti Group America, the Fort Lauderdale-based Americas headquarters for the Italian yacht conglomerate. The Ferretti 690 made its US debut this February during the Miami Yacht & Brokerage Show and is undoubtedly one of the most innovative yachts that Ferretti Yachts has produced below 70 feet with a full beam master; and largest in-category salon, cockpit and fly bridge. Other packages can be customized based on a buyer’s individual desires.

“The offer is ideally suited toward those who appreciate South Florida’s boating lifestyle, including Ferretti’s Latin American and international customers who are buying second homes and keeping their boats in a place many call the ‘Yachting Capital of the World,'” Keating said. “Marina Palms’ location on Biscayne Boulevard and the Intracoastal, just minutes from Haulover Inlet, make this project a great location for any boat or yacht owner.”
